Book Excerpt

And a brief for half thy land.

"Here as thou sitt'st at thy wide board,

Hail Monarch of the Danes!
Thou shalt to me thy daughter give,

And the half of thy domains.

"Thou shalt to me thy daughter give,

And divide with me thy land,
Or thou shalt find a kempion good

In the ring 'gainst me to stand."

"O thou shalt ne'er my daughter get,

Nor a brief for half my land,
I'll quickly find a kempion good

Shall fight thee hand to hand."

Then strode the Monarch of the Danes

To his castle hall amain:
"Now which of ye, my courtiers, will
